It’s no secret that explosive allegations could be filed today against Illinois Treasurer Dan Rutherford.

The attorney for Rutherford’s former employee told WLS Radio’s “Bruce & Dan” this morning that she’s planning to file early afternoon, leveling serious allegations against the GOP gubernatorial candidate.

“Obviously the allegations are false. If there is a lawsuit filed today then the Treasurer will respond,” his spokeswoman Mary Frances Bragiel said. “He’ll possibly have a media avail if something is filed today.”

In a Jan. 31 press conference, Rutherford said: “There’s absolutely no truth to the allegations. No factual support or merit.”
